Overview
We are looking for to hire a Project Manager / Business Analyst to join our IT department. This role will be responsible for managing projects of different nature depending on business needs, including digital initiatives as well as fast-track internal projects. The position will be part of the IT team and will collaborate closely with Technology Operations, Architecture, and Service Owners.
Responsibilities
- Lead projects adopting the Project Manager role, ensuring delivery within time, scope, and budget.
- Perform exhaustive tracking of projects, adhering to the company’s internal methodology, ensuring proper project documentation, understanding business requirements, and technical elements to be modified or created from scratch.
- Execute proof of concepts: Drive pilots and proof of concept initiatives to test business needs before launching a high-impact project, aligned with Sofinco methodology.
- Identify processes that need to be created or modified and communicate them to both technical and business areas.
- Coordinate teams and facilitate communication across technology department areas to ensure alignment and project success.
- Manage and interact with different providers involved in assigned projects.
- Coordinate and support business units (stakeholders) and users; collaborate with various areas to support transversal initiatives.
- Lead projects using Salesforce, Microservices (Java, Spring Boot), APIs, Talend, WSO2; collaborate on integration between Salesforce and external systems using APIs.
